TV anchor Arnab Goswami gets relief from Supreme Court, interim bail. Two accused, including Arnab Goswami, have also got interim bail in the case of the charge of abetment of suicide. The apex court has directed the jail administration and the commissioner to ensure that the order is followed.

The court granted interim bail to Arnab after hearing a bail plea filed by Republic TV editor-in-chief Arnab Goswami’s bail plea on Wednesday. Two accused, including Arnab, have also got bail in the case of the charge of abetment of suicide. The apex court directed the jail administration and the commissioner to ensure that the order is followed and said that they do not want the release to be delayed by two days.

The Supreme Court said that if it had asked the lower court to impose bail conditions, it would have taken two more days, so we have asked to file a personal bond of 50,000 with the jail administration. Explain that the Bombay High Court had refused to bail Arnab, after which he went to the Supreme Court.

The case was heard by a bench of Justice DY Chandrachud and Justice Indira Banerjee. Let me tell you that during the hearing, Justice Chandrachud said that if the court does not interfere in this case, then it will proceed on the path of destruction. The court said that ‘you may differ in ideology but constitutional courts have to protect such freedom or else we are on the path of destruction.

Justice Chandrachud also said that it is better for the Supreme Court to ignore the legal aspects of the case as the issue is pending there and will be limited to the point of interim relief. Even in cases of anticipatory bail, the courts pass an interim order not to make an arrest while a notice is issued to the prosecution.

Advocate Harish Salve, who is holding Arnab’s case, had argued in favor of bail saying that “Are Arnab Goswami a terrorist?” Are they accused of murder? Why can’t they be granted bail? He argued that ‘suicide must be the intention to commit suicide and this is the most important aspect. There is no intention in this matter. The Supreme Court has said in many rulings that there should be intention for suicide which is not here. If a person commits suicide in Maharashtra and blames the government, will the Chief Minister be arrested? ‘
